    What you downloaded is only part of the story.   The license code defines what the downloaded app does.   Depending upon the license code you'll get full pro capabilitites, Nikon only capabilities, etc.  Once you enter a code it is remembered.  Downloading and re-installing another binary doesn't help change codes.

    Start up Capture One

    Click on Capture One -> License from the menu.  That will tell you which license you are using.   If it is the wrong license and you have a code for the proper license you can deactivate the license in use.   I believe you will then be able to reactivate using the correct license.

    But don't trust me... I'm just another user.   Contact Capture One support.
